Each artifact includes a detached signature and a manifest of cache-eviction policy defaults. Reviewers should verify the signature before approving deployment to any edge node, and confirm the build provenance attestation matches the tagged commit. Unsigned or mismatched artifacts must be rejected and reported to the platform security rotation. All current releases are verified against the public half of the key shown below.

rollout seal: bky4_x7Gc

## Runbook — EXIF Scrubbing (Plateworks Upload Pipeline)

All images passing through the Plateworks ingest queue must have EXIF metadata stripped before reaching public storage. The scrubber runs as a sidecar on each ingest worker; if it crashes, uploads queue rather than bypass it — never disable the block. To verify scrubbing, pull a sample from the post-scrub bucket and inspect headers; GPS and serial fields must be absent. If backlog exceeds ten minutes, scale the worker pool first. The scrubber reads its settings from the values below.

settings of tajep-tafog:
CASDOR_LOG_LEVEL=info
CASDOR_METRICS_HOST=metrics.casdor.nelvrosys.internal
CASDOR_POOL_SIZE=16

Subject: Quickstore 4.2 — bloom filter now fronts the KV layer

Plugin authors: starting with this release, Quickstore places a bloom filter ahead of the key-value store. Negative lookups return faster; false positives fall through safely. No API changes are required on your side. Verify your plugin against the staging build referenced below.

session token of fahif-tadup = htk3_9c7

Plugins failing the handshake will be quarantined, not silently skipped, so expect new alerts under the quarantine channel. The retry loop now backs off after three attempts; do not restart the loader manually unless the quarantine count exceeds ten. Rollback instructions live in the Fernwick runbook, section four. If anything looks off during your shift, the final call on disabling a plugin rests with the following owner.

signatory, yagap-bawig: Ulaath Eliath